FINALLY! ‘Sasural Simar Ka’ to go OFF AIR!

New Delhi: Colors Television’s most popular show ‘Sasural Simar Ka’ started five years ago and has been one of the longest running shows. Recently, soap opera completed 1600 episodes. But as they say that all good things come to an end. Same is the case with this show, which started with the tale of two sisters but turned into a spooky show. Now according to the reports in Indiaforums, show is all set to go off air in the next two months. TRP of the show has been going down on a frequent basis. Makers of the show introduced the leap track, in order to attract some attention, but that also failed badly. There were also speculations that many of the actors did not wanted to play older roles. When actor Varun Sharma was contacted for this, actor said that they don’t have any idea about this. Talking about the show’s TRP, actor said that there are many other shows on the channel that are not doing well, and our show will do better in the coming weeks. We all know that show lost its prime time slot 7:30pm and is now at 6pm which resulted in the fall of TRP. It is also being speculated that channel is soon going to launch new show which include Bigg Boss! Well, let’s see if show continues its spooky saga or comes to an end!
